Is Morton's clean?

Morton's is currently Pass from Boston Inspectional Services, Health Division, from an inspection on June 30, 2011. No critical violations were recorded at that visit. On Cooked's ladder that reads clean ๐Ÿ˜‡.

What did inspectors find at Morton's?

Nothing was written up at the most recent inspection on June 30, 2011. A clean sheet like this is the best possible result โ€” no violations of any severity were recorded.

How Boston grades restaurants

Boston reports inspections as a pass or a fail, with no score and no letter. What separates a bad fail from a trivial one is the violation severity ladder: a single star is a minor issue, two stars is more serious, and three stars marks a critical foodborne-illness risk factor โ€” temperature abuse, bad handwashing, cross-contamination. A restaurant can fail on paperwork alone, which is not the same as failing on food safety. Cooked splits Boston fails accordingly: a fail with a three-star violation reads cooked, a fail on minor items only reads mid.
